Roof leak patching services involve the process of identifying and sealing areas of your roof where water may be entering. This typically includes inspecting the roof for damaged shingles, cracked flashing, or other vulnerabilities that can develop over time due to weather exposure or aging materials. Once the problem spots are located, trained contractors can apply specialized sealants, patches, or other repair techniques to stop leaks and prevent further water intrusion. This service is often a quick and effective way to address small to moderate leaks before they cause more extensive damage to the roof structure or interior of a property.
These services help resolve common issues such as water stains on ceilings, damp or musty attic spaces, and peeling paint inside the home. Left unaddressed, roof leaks can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and damage to insulation or electrical systems. Patching is a practical solution for homeowners experiencing localized leaks, especially after storms or severe weather events. It can also serve as a temporary fix while planning more comprehensive roof repairs or replacements, reducing the risk of costly interior damage and preserving the integrity of the property.

The overview below groups typical Roof Leak Patching proj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Newton,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or roof leak patching in Newton range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ering small areas or localized leaks.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this range unless additional repairs are needed.
Moderate Repairs - for larger patches or multiple leak areas,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. These projects may involve more extensive work on the roof surface but generally remain within this moderate cost band. Larger, more complex repairs can push costs higher.
Major Repairs - extensive leak patching or repairs on a significant portion of a roof can typically cost from $1,500 to $3,500. Such projects are less common but necessary for severe damage or longstanding leaks. Costs in this range reflect increased labor and material requirements.
Full Roof Replacement - when patching is insufficient, full replacement costs in the Newton area can start around $8,000 and go beyond $15,000. These are larger projects handled by local pros and are less frequent, usually reserved for longstanding or widespread roof iss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es roof leaks that need patching? Roof leaks can result from damaged shingles, aging materials, or severe weather conditions that compromise the roof's integrity, leading to the need for patching services.
How do local contractors typically patch roof leaks? Contractors usually identify the leak source, remove damaged materials, and apply appropriate patching materials to seal the affected area and prevent further water intrusion.
Can roof leak patching be a temporary fix or is it permanent? Roof patching is generally considered a repair to address immediate leaks; for long-term protection, additional roof maintenance or replacement may be recommended.
What signs indicate that a roof needs leak patching?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, damp or moldy areas, and visible damage or missing shingles that suggest a leak is present.
